Essential Tools and Measurements before Starting Installation


You stand in a quiet garage, tools laid out like a chessboard, ready to make the first cut. Measuring twice becomes a ritual; a small margin saved today avoids headaches later.

Start with a tape measure, level, stud finder and quality drill. Add safety gear: gloves, eye protection, and a flashlight for tight spaces. Label parts to speed reassembly.

Record bolt sizes, wire lengths and clearance requirements on paper or a phone photo. Double check electrical ratings and local codes before any cuts or connections.

A measured plan turns sweat into efficient progress; go slowly, verify fits, and keep spare fasteners and wire on hand. Preparation saves time and prevents costly callbacks — and take photos.



Choosing the Perfect Location for Optimal Performance



I stood on the roof at dawn, tracking how sunlight moved across the tiles. For an iversun array, prioritize a sun-rich, unshaded zone with true southern exposure in the northern hemisphere (reverse this if you are south of the equator).

Consider roof pitch and panel tilt; matching tilt to latitude boosts generation. Avoid nearby trees, chimneys, or HVAC units that cast intermittent shade. Accessibility matters too—good access eases cleaning, repairs, and inverter placement to minimize cable runs and energy loss.

Check local codes, wind load, and snow load requirements, and consider microclimates that might heat or cool modules unevenly. A little planning up front keeps an iversun system efficient, safe, and simple to maintain reliably.



Clear Step by Step Wiring and Mounting


Starting the wiring, imagine tracing a clear path from the main panel to the iversun unit, labeling each conductor as you go. Use cable clips and conduit to secure runs, maintain consistent bend radii, and leave service loops for future adjustments. Verify polarity and grounding at every junction; a multimeter and torque wrench are your best friends to ensure tight, safe connections.

Mounting requires leveled brackets and hardware rated for exterior use — pre-drill pilot holes and use stainless steel fasteners to prevent corrosion. After affixing the bracket, test structural integrity with a gentle pull, then connect low-voltage signaling last. Document your wiring with photos and labels so future troubleshooting is quick, safe and precise.



Sealing, Insulation, and Weatherproofing Best Practices



I remember the first rooftop iversun install: the rush of seeing panels align and hush when the sealant dried. Begin by cleaning surfaces thoroughly, applying high-quality silicone or polyurethane; press flashing into seams and allow proper cure time to prevent leaks. Use compatible tapes for corners and gaps.

Insulate junction boxes and conduit entries with closed-cell foam and protect exposed wiring with UV-rated conduit. Maintain a slight slope for runoff and inspect seals annually after storms; quick touch-ups with sealant will preserve efficiency and prevent moisture damage and extend longevity.



Troubleshooting Common Issues and Quick Fixes


On the first installation day, a silent unit can feel defeating. Check power basics: breakers, fuses, and a firm plug; many faults stem from loose connections. For iversun models, confirm the battery and inverter link—re-seat terminals and test with a multimeter to isolate voltage drops before replacing components.

Intermittent performance often traces to grounding, corroded terminals, or software settings. Tighten connections, clean contacts with isopropyl, and update firmware via the companion app. If sensors misread, recalibrate following the manual and swap suspicious leads; a quick continuity check saves hours and prevents unnecessary part swaps.

Temperature and sealing issues reduce lifespan; inspect gaskets, vents, and cable glands. Reseat foam blocks and apply silicone where needed. Keep a log of error codes and photos—support teams respond faster with evidence. Routine cleaning and torque checks every six months keep system reliable and efficient.

Maintenance Tips to Extend Lifespan and Efficiency


Every spring I walk the rooftop, checking connectors and dust accumulation; gentle cleaning with a soft brush and periodic torque checks keep units efficient. Record voltage logs to spot declines.

Monitor inverter temperatures and listen for unusual noise; thermal imaging once yearly reveals hotspots before failure. Keep firmware updated and maintain clear airflow zones to prevent heat-related derating system issues.

Document all maintenance tasks in a log; trends reveal performance drift. Replace aging fans and capacitors proactively. If alarms persist, consult technical manuals or accredited service engineers for safe resolution.
